Location and Accessibility
Leo Carrillo Campground is located at 20000 Pacific Coast Highway, Malibu, CA 90265. The campground is easily accessible via the Pacific Coast Highway, just a short drive from Los Angeles. The drive from downtown Los Angeles takes approximately 45 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.
For those without a car, public transportation is available. The Malibu/Santa Monica Bus offers service to Leo Carrillo State Park, with a stop near the campground. However, it’s important to note that the bus schedule may be limited, so it’s best to check the schedule in advance.

Campground Layout
Leo Carrillo Campground is divided into two sections: the Upper Campground and the Lower Campground. The Upper Campground is located at a higher elevation and offers more privacy, while the Lower Campground is closer to the beach and offers more direct access to the Pacific Ocean.
The campground features a variety of campsite options, including tent sites, RV sites, and group sites. Each campsite is equipped with a picnic table, fire ring, and a grill. Campers can choose from a variety of sites based on their preferences and the size of their group.
